Team-wide Financial Engagement (also known as open book management or OBM) is the practice of creating transparency by sharing business financial information with your team to teach them how to think like owners. Businesses that implement TFE are more profitable and have higher employee retention than those that operate with a traditional, hierarchical structure.
But not all businesses are ready for TFE. In this lecture course, the Prepshift team will introduce you to the fundamental conditions necessary to operate a TFE program so that you can evaluate if this management system is right for you and your team. This course is suitable for W-2 owners and managers and is available in person or virtually. |
